Artificial Intelligence Literacy

Artificial Intelligence or Augmented Intelligence (AI) applications are becoming more and more prevalent also in Anesthesiology.

Similar to other technologies that we use every day in the care of our patients, we should become proficient also in AI to protect our patients. Understanding the fundamentals of AI, its functions and limitations will allow us to intervene before inappropriate information or AI-based decisions can potentially harm patients. Achieving what we consider "AI literacy" is important so we remain in the loop not only for patient safety reasons, but also to be able to contribute to (ethical) discussions, research and development in this accelerating and exciting new field.
